12 Best Pro Tips to Caring for your Jewellery in Pakistan 2023/ 2024 from Scratches, Breaking and Dullness

  1. Chemicals and wood surfaces cannot be a great friend of your jewellery and can cause strain or speed up the tarnishing process.
  2.  Gently rub gold and silver jewellery items with a soft, clean cloth to augment the shine. Make sure the cloth you use is soft, not hard and is clean or else it can result in giving bad patches or scratches to your jewellery.
  3. jewellery set with gems can be rejuvenated by cautious cleaning with a soft brush and soapy water, or with a propriety jewellery cleaning solution. TRY not to get threaded pearl or beaded jewellery wet and only wet antique jewellery ONLY IF A JEWELRY EXPERT TELLS YOU TO – you could ruin it.
  4. Keep your jewellery safe in a Ziplock bag. Over the long haul, your jewellery comes in contact with dampness and air which makes it ultimately discolours. Put it in a Ziplock bag and squeeze out all the air before sealing.
  5. You can use silver ‘dip’ type cleaners on most silver jewellery– yet rinse and dry them altogether. Try not to use silver ‘dip’ type cleaning solutions on gold jewellery, only good jewellery cleaners.   6. To avoid your jewellery getting tangled up, keep them safe and separate in a drawer, not jumbled up together.
  7. Store your silver jewellery with chalk. Chalk ingests moisture, or in the event that you find that dusty, invest in some dehumidifiers or silica packs. THAT HELPS!
  8. Never ever wear your jewellery then apply lotions, hairspray and perfumes. Keep your jewellery stuff away from skincare and keep them dry. Avoid wearing jewellery when going swimming or to the sauna.
  9. Sunlight can be very harmful to your jewellery and can cause discolouration or fadedness. Too much light is harmful!
  10. Put your jewellery pieces on the turn. jewellery isn’t intended to be worn every minute of every day, give it a break and show some adoration to other pieces of jewellery too.
  11. Keep gold jewellery away from silver jewellery. Gold scratches effectively, so keep them separately in soft material bags or the original boxes they came it.
  12. Home remedies can be stupid at times and can destroy your jewellery to a great extent where they won’t be wearable. Don’t, I REPEAT never use toothpaste, this home remedy is abrasive and will surely damage your jewellery. But for those pieces that are dull, filmy or starting to tarnish, mix warm water and dish soap and rub it on the jewellery with a very soft cloth. Then rinse it in cold water and dry it with a clean, soft cloth. In case of any damage or broken, take your jewellery pieces to any jeweller and they will fix it for you if you are looking for solutions to clean them with, consult your jeweller, they will guide you with the best!

Jewellery – General Care:

 

image source : Pinterest
  1. Don’t wear your jewellery while sleeping, it can easily damage your jewellery or take it off if you are involved in any activity that can easily knock or damage it.
  2. Keep them away from chemicals, especially chlorine. But if something like this happens, immediately rinse it off.
  3. Make separate boxes for different kinds, e.g., Rings should be stored together, Necklaces with Necklaces only, same goes for Earrings.

Below is a quick checklist of some of the things to look out for:

  • Damaged or missing claws can risk losing stones.
  • Any fractures in metals
  • loose materials and catches or rough links on chains or bracelets
  • pearls that are loose or the thread is frayed
  • if a ring is too tight or too loose, it can be re-sized
